Study Notes

Growth Mindset

  • The term "growth mindset" was coined by Carol Dweck.
  • A fixed mindset refers to the belief that one's abilities and intelligence are fixed and unchangeable.
  • According to the text, having a growth mindset can change the way we approach learning.
  • The main focus of the text is the concept of a growth mindset and its significance in learning.

Fixed Mindset Beliefs

  • People with a fixed mindset believe that their skills and abilities are innate and unchangeable.
